If you want earplug type protection at a sensible price I can recommend Emtec Noisebreakers.

These are moulded to fit your ears and have a mechanical valve so you can hear conversations (sort of) but any loud reports are totally cut out. I paid about £70 for mine a few years ago but they get used once a week and are so comfortable you really don't notice them.

You can pay a lot more for the moulded electronic types which I'm sure are very good, but I personally like to hear nothing when I'm shooting and I can't think of anything I'd like less than being able to hear folks chatting etc while I'm trying to shoot.

I too don't like things in my ear. I've tried various types of plug including custom moulded, but still prefer the convenience and sound proofing of a good set of muffs.

I currently use MSA Sordin Supreme Pro muffs and I've had Peltor and Deben electronic types in the past. The Sordins offer me the best comfort, light weight and best sound reproduction so far. It's a far more natural sound compared to sounding like you are listening to a cheap transistor radio.

The best bit is turn on/turn off instantly for really good sound deadening, and the setting of your preferred volume to hear speech or trap releases etc.  Certainly my favourites.   :biggrin:
